I know what most people are going to think. Wade is too old, would be too pricey, and doesn't fit with our core. But, he's a champion and an all-time great player who still commands the respect of the officials. Harris and Morris can both play PF, and last year Morris even wanted to play more at PF. There is no better 3 point shooting option at the 4 spot than simply shifting their minutes there. Let Wade and KCP start at the wing spots. Let them guard opposing 2 and 3s based on particular matchups. If a matchup is bad for us we can simply sub in Morris at about the 6 minute mark if we need more size at the SF spot. Big thing is, if Wade leaves Miami you know he's going to have a huge chip on his shoulder after Riley throws him aside instead of paying him a reasonable offer for what he's done for the team. He's going to still draw the attention of opposing defenses. If we can get him to sign for something like 2 years, $40 million it also gives us a huge expiring contract at next year's trade deadline if he isn't looking like he'll be an important piece for a 2018 playoff run.

Bad in soooo many ways.

First of all, Miami isn't going to be stupid like the Lakers and give a golden parachute to Wade. They want Wade to act more like Duncan has with the Spurs. Paying Wade $20M to be "respected" is a very, very dumb move.

Second of all, just because Wade had some bright moments in the playoffs doesn't mean he is a star anymore. He is an average player and he has had a bunch of injuries. And he is old. He is not getting better, but getting worse. He is probably not even worth the 8-10M that Miami has offered him.

The only way he fits on our team if he totally accepts a bench role. He couldn't beat out KCP, so he shouldn't dream of doing it. And we still would only want to pay him somewhere around what Miami is offering him anyway.
